Output e526bfef53aa76ef696f8e7e6fd92850f4fe5fa8ed4e15b79365f6d100b9993c:20

value
23208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93c279a43f9995f46b5662a245ca3a65a8446378 OP_EQUAL
address
3FAJE7ZkvQmYtszVdUDQV4tx4kqHH6bXLp
transaction
e526bfef53aa76ef696f8e7e6fd92850f4fe5fa8ed4e15b79365f6d100b9993c
confirmations
248264
spent
true